Online Labor Demand Drops in May
Online advertised vacancies dipped 45,700 in May to 4,714,800, according to The Conference Board’s Help Wanted OnLine Data Series (HWOL). The supply/demand rate stands at 2.6 unemployed for every vacancy. In May the number of unemployed was 7.7 million above the number of advertised vacancies, compared to 10 million above in the fall of 2011.
